Hurst shifter stick isolator kit.  If you are experiencing mild vibration and noise transmitted through the shifter stick, this kit will reduce the behavior.  It probably won't eliminate it, as this kit does not achieve the same level of isolation as a stock shifter, but it is usually worthwhile.  However understand that any isolation will reduce shift quality and precision, and so it should only be done when necessary, and is NOT recommended for competitive driving or other high-stress situations.

Kit includes:

  • Hurst rubber (neoprene) isolator pads (qty 2, one for each side of stick)
  • Hurst steel isolator pad coverplate
  • Mounting bolts; choose from:
    • 3/8"-24 x 1 1/4" w/ back nuts - for most Hurst & Core stubs w/ flat face on each side of stub
    • 3/8"-24 x 1" w/o nuts - for angled Core stubs where back side is not flat and nuts cannot be used - loctite must be used instead
    • M8 x 35mm w/ nuts - for OEM & off-brand stubs that have M8 threads

This kit is not intended to mask internal problems of the transmission, clutch (and related clutch components), or engine components that may have been modified and/or have degraded.  Aftermarket cams, exhaust, single-mass flywheels, and slightly out-of-balance driveline parts (or wheels / tires) can introduce significant harmonics that are difficult to isolate.  Each vehicle is different and harmonics can vary with driving style, vehicle condition, road surface - many things. Thus, the kit may work better in some vehicles than others and may not completely eliminate vibration noise to every customer’s satisfaction but should improve it over a solid coupling.
